Finn 873 Posted January 31, 2011 Share Posted January 31, 2011 Standard FSX searchlight keypresses don´´t work. You need to use the VC colective cooliehat for moving the searchlight. Note that the default Bell 206 has an adjustable LANDING light. The Huey X has a landing light AND a searchlight, thats why we didn´t succeed making the standard key presses work.
